Why Fujairah Is More Than Just a Free Zone

Fujairah is the only emirate in the UAE with direct access to the Indian Ocean, bypassing the congested Strait of Hormuz entirely. This geographical advantage makes it uniquely valuable for shipping, logistics, and trade companies that depend on efficient global supply chains. Home to the Port of Fujairah, one of the world’s largest bunkering hubs, the emirate is already a critical node in international maritime commerce.

But Fujairah’s appeal extends well beyond its ports. The emirate has grown its economy by approximately one third since 2021, with year-on-year growth sitting around 8%. These are not just impressive numbers; they reflect a real, diversifying economy spanning energy, tourism, manufacturing, media, and professional services.

Strategic Location That Opens Global Markets

Located on the UAE’s east coast, Fujairah sits roughly 90 minutes from Dubai. Yet its position on the Gulf of Oman gives it direct shipping access that no other emirate can offer. For import-export businesses, logistics operators, and industrial firms, this translates into faster routes, lower freight costs, and reduced dependency on passage through high-traffic international straits.

The ongoing development of the port under Fujairah Plan 2040 including expansion of container, dry-bulk, and oil terminals further cements the emirate’s role as a regional trade gateway.

A Growing Economy Built for Entrepreneurs

Fujairah’s business environment is designed with entrepreneurs and SMEs in mind. The emirate supports 100% foreign ownership in its free zones, offers zero corporate and personal income tax on qualifying activities, and provides streamlined visa pathways including the UAE Golden Visa for qualifying business owners.

Unlike many larger free zones, Fujairah Creative City does not require annual audit submissions and allows professionals to set up their company without an NOC from an existing UAE employer, a rare and significant advantage for those already working in the country.

Industries Thriving in Fujairah Today

The emirate supports a remarkably broad spectrum of industries. In the free zones, sectors like media production, marketing, design, technology, consultancy, education, and e-commerce are all active and growing. Outside the free zones, Fujairah is home to a flourishing oil and gas sector, a busy manufacturing base, and one of the UAE’s most scenic and fast-growing tourism industries.

Fujairah’s historical mining sector has also benefitted from the ongoing construction boom across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and Ras Al Khaimah adding another dimension to an already diversified economic picture.

Fujairah Creative City: The Creative and Media Hub

For professionals in media, communications, advertising, entertainment, and technology, Fujairah Creative City (FCC) is the standout free zone. Established under the Fujairah Culture and Media Authority, FCC provides world-class telecom connectivity, virtual office options, coworking spaces, and dedicated administrative support — all at a more competitive price point than comparable zones in Dubai.

Businesses registered at FCC also benefit from access to the UAE’s corporate banking system, with the free zone providing essential documentation to connect companies with both local and international banks.
